Western Blot: Niemann-Pick C1 Antibody (1318A) - Azide and BSA Free [NBP2-80879] - Total protein from human HeLa, Hek293, mouse 3T3 and Rat PC12 cell lines were separated on a 7.5% gel by SDS-PAGE, transferred to PVDF membrane and blocked in 5% non-fat milk in TBST. The membrane was probed with 2.0 ug/ml anti-NPC1 in block buffer and detected with an anti-rabbit HRP secondary antibody using West Pico PLUS chemiluminescence detection reagent. Image from the standard format of this antibody.

Immunocytochemistry/Immunofluorescence: Niemann-Pick C1 Antibody (1318A) - Azide and BSA Free [NBP2-80879] - HeLa cells were fixed in 4% paraformaldehyde for 10 min and permeabilized in 0.05% Triton X-100 for 5 minutes. The cells were incubated with anti- Niemann-Pick C1 Antibody at 2 ug/ml for 60 minutes at room temperature and detected with an anti-rabbit Dylight 488 (Green) at a 1:1000 dilution for 60 minutes. Nuclei were counterstained with DAPI (Blue). Cells were imaged using a 100X objective and digitally deconvolved. Image from the standard format of this antibody.

Western Blot: Niemann-Pick C1 Antibody (1318A) - Azide and BSA Free [NBP2-80879] - Western blot shows lysates of HeLa human cervical epithelial carcinoma parental cell line and Niemann-Pick Type C1/NPC1 knockout HeLa cell line (KO). PVDF membrane was probed with 0.5 ug/mL of Rabbit Anti-Human/Mouse/Rat Niemann-Pick Type C1/NPC1 Monoclonal Antibody (Catalog # MAB10105) followed by HRP-conjugated Anti-Rabbit IgG Secondary Antibody (Catalog # HAF008). A specific band was detected for Niemann-Pick Type C1/NPC1 at approximately 170-250 kDa (as indicated) in the parental HeLa cell line, but is not detectable in knockout HeLa cell line. GAPDH (Catalog # MAB5718) is shown as a loading control. This experiment was conducted under reducing conditions. Image from the standard format of this antibody.

Background: Niemann-Pick Type C1/NPC1

Niemann-Pick type C1 (NPC1) is a member of a family of genes encoding membrane-bound proteins containing putative sterol sensing domains. NPC1 protein regulates cholesterol transport from late endosomes-lysosomes to other intracellular compartments. NPC1 overexpression increases the rate of trafficking of low density lipoprotein cholesterol to the endoplasmic reticulum and the rate of delivery of endosomal cholesterol to the plasma membrane. NPC disease is an inherited neurovisceral lipid storage disorder of unesterified cholesterol accumulation in lysosomes. It is characterized by progressive neural and liver degeneration, resulting from inactivating mutations in NPC1, in most cases.
